Making and Receiving Calls

Note: Before you can use your Bluetooth-enabled phone, you must first create a paired link (see “Linking Your Car Kit and Bluetooth Enabled Device”).

The following table provides details for making and receiving calls from your connected phone using your car kit:

Note: Some features are phone/network dependent.
